(1) Compute the resonant frequency of 31P, 1H, and 2H at 2.0 Tesla and at 3.0 Tesla

(2)

(a) Given an RF pulse with a bandwidth of 1000 Hz (this is f, not omega) centered at the Larmor frequency for a 2.0 Tesla field, what slice select gradient strength is needed in order to excite a 2-mm slice in a homogeneous water phantom?




(b) (2 pts) How would you excite a 20 mm slice with the exact same RF pulse?





(c) (3 pts) How would you excite a 20 mm slice with the exact same gradients (you can change the pulse sequence.
